So Easy to Install and Use, Works Very Well
Originally, I had the Brother 1100 Pro-Type Model for my business, so I could print my own Shipping Labels and save time and money. It worked great for a while, then stopped working all together (Wouldn't turn on). I took it to be repaired at an Office Supplies Store that did repairs. It turned out to be a computer board in the machine that couldn't be replaced. The repair Tech told me to buy a DYMO Label Printing Machine, which I did. I set it up and it kept telling me it was out of Labels! It was full of labels, and they were DYMO Brand! After four hours of trying to make it work, I gave up and set out to find one that worked! I found the POLONO Thermal Label Printer, 4x6 Shipping Label Printer on Amazon while checking different machines and their reviews. Overall reviews were good, only issue some buyers stated was quality of print. I purchased the machine, along with the feeder tray and several boxes of POLONO Thermal Shipping Labels (4"x6"). Upon receiving the machine and accessories, I went about setting it up. It was a breeze setting up the machine and the accessories and downloading the software, that comes with the machine on a Thumb drive. After downloading the software, I went to the POLONO Website and did a search for latest updates and completed that task. Once the machine was uploaded on to my computer, I went into my computer's Settings, Printers and Scanners, Select the POLONO Label Printer, Click on Manage, then go the Printer Preferences and select the Print Darkness and select Custom and move the arrow to the darkest setting. Then chose Speed and select Custom and move the arrow to the slowest speed setting. This will give you nice quality Thermal Shipping Labels and resolve the issue so many other customers had. After easy setup, I printed a Test Label and the machine worked perfectly, printing out a great Shipping Label. Since I set the POLONO up, I've printed out over 50 UPS Shipping Labels and have had no problems with the machine printing the labels, the printing quality and every UPC Bar Code was easily read by the UPS Shipping Label Reader. Excellent machine, easy setup and easy to use. Would recommend to anyone needing a good quality, reasonably priced label printing machine.

So this is based on my day 1 impression of it - I'll come back and update the review if anything changes. First impression are good; the photos in the ad don't really do it justice, it "feels" like good quality (but as always, time will tell). Packaging was good and it came with everything that was listed (printer, label holder, USB Stick, Power and USB cables, sample black labels etc). I found setting it up super easy; I didn't bother reading the manual. I just sat it where I wanted it, clipped the label caddy together (and put the spool on), plugged the printer in to the power and the computer, downloaded and installed the drivers from the official site (very easy to find them), lifted the lid and placed the labels about half way in (remembering to set the holder width correctly) and then on shutting the lid the printer automatically moved the label to the correct start location. I made sure to tell Etsy/Ebay to generate 4x6 inch labels and then sent one to print and off it went. Printed fine first time and took about 1 second; print quality is good for the use case, text was all readable, QR and Bar Codes looked like they should scan just fine. I would say the print quality is better than a low end inkjet printer would produce. ** Note: I'm using a roll of the cheapest labels I could find at around £6 for 500 - cheap labels didn't seem to have any impact on print quality or operation of the unit ** Default settings are perfectly acceptable but I did set the "Density" a couple of notches higher in the printer preferences just to add a little more thickness to the text (QR and Bar Codes still looked fine). Really nothing to complain about. Recap: - Feels like a good quality well made unit, time will tell - Couldn't have been any easier to set up (MAKE SURE YOU SET YOUR LABEL GENERATOR TO THE CORRECT PAPER SIZE!!!) - Prints fast with perfectly acceptable print quality. Would recommend :)
